云原生集成開發(fā)環(huán)境——TitanIDE
通過網(wǎng)頁(yè)在任何地方更安全、更高效地編碼2022-07-07
815
終端用戶需求的增加迫使企業(yè)面臨許多挑戰(zhàn),以提高其運(yùn)營(yíng)效率和生產(chǎn)力。此外,市場(chǎng)的不斷演變?cè)谄仁蛊髽I(yè)取得最佳結(jié)果方面發(fā)揮了有利的作用。
為了克服和消除所有這些麻煩,企業(yè)可以選擇 DevOps 文化,這種文化可以為他們的團(tuán)隊(duì)帶來(lái)協(xié)作性質(zhì)的工作。這里是關(guān)于簡(jiǎn)要介紹 DevOps 及其對(duì)組織的好處(運(yùn)營(yíng)和業(yè)務(wù))。
什么是 DevOps?
DevOps 通過一系列的方法和實(shí)踐為組織帶來(lái)了快速的增長(zhǎng)或發(fā)展。簡(jiǎn)而言之,DevOps 可以被定義為一種增強(qiáng)組織的開發(fā)和運(yùn)營(yíng)能力的工具。
它強(qiáng)制執(zhí)行一個(gè)協(xié)作的勞動(dòng)力和帶來(lái)文化變革,以提高企業(yè)價(jià)值觀。雖然 DevOps 給組織帶來(lái)了更多的好處,但它仍然會(huì)因組織工作流和結(jié)構(gòu)的不同而有所不同。
為什么 DevOps 對(duì)組織很重要?
今天的市場(chǎng)是根據(jù)用戶的行為和趨勢(shì)不斷發(fā)展的。為了處理這些變化并帶來(lái)更多的操作價(jià)值,DevOps 的實(shí)現(xiàn)對(duì)于組織來(lái)說變得至關(guān)重要。
下面列出了使 DevOps 成為必不可少的原因:
1.在團(tuán)隊(duì)之間建立協(xié)作
2.提供連續(xù)測(cè)試環(huán)境
3.加強(qiáng)業(yè)務(wù)能力,以管理更快的部署
4.帶來(lái)監(jiān)控性能的能力
5.提高企業(yè)投資回報(bào)率
然而,DevOps 提供的好處可以分為3種類型: 技術(shù)好處、操作好處和業(yè)務(wù)好處。接下來(lái)的章節(jié)將詳細(xì)說明一個(gè)組織通過實(shí)施 DevOps 可以獲得的業(yè)務(wù)和業(yè)務(wù)效益。
DevOps 的運(yùn)營(yíng)效益
DevOps 的最終目標(biāo)是為組織帶來(lái)更高的效率、成本效益以及可伸縮性特性。更加依賴前端運(yùn)營(yíng)的企業(yè)可以通過 DevOps 獲得更多的利益。DevOps 除了為業(yè)務(wù)帶來(lái)更多的穩(wěn)定性之外,還允許業(yè)務(wù)涉眾將其業(yè)務(wù)操作與其業(yè)務(wù)目標(biāo)同步。
通過這樣做,每個(gè)員工都知道他們的目標(biāo),并將努力實(shí)現(xiàn)它。簡(jiǎn)單地看一下 DevOps 的運(yùn)營(yíng)好處。
1. 穩(wěn)定運(yùn)行
幾乎每個(gè)組織都在努力處理耦合服務(wù)、對(duì)第三方應(yīng)用程序的依賴以及增加到達(dá)市場(chǎng)的時(shí)間。通過實(shí)現(xiàn) DevOps,這些麻煩將很容易消除。它從業(yè)務(wù)規(guī)劃、開發(fā)和交付鏈中為業(yè)務(wù)帶來(lái)了更多的控制。
下面是 DevOps 在業(yè)務(wù)操作中管理的方面的列表:
*提供業(yè)務(wù)基礎(chǔ)設(shè)施。
*增加服務(wù)可用性。
*幫助發(fā)布更新。
*覆蓋了所有的安全漏洞。
與 DevOps 一起工作的團(tuán)隊(duì)可以利用定義良好的工作流的力量,這些工作流通常與工具和流程同步。有一個(gè)組織良好的 DevOps 戰(zhàn)略將加強(qiáng) CI/CD 管道。然而,實(shí)現(xiàn) DevOps 策略并不容易。您將需要團(tuán)隊(duì)之間的卓越協(xié)作、卓越的信息共享以及卓越的業(yè)務(wù)操作同步。
2. 操作同步
擁有良好同步的業(yè)務(wù)操作將確保您的業(yè)務(wù)的操作能力滿足不斷發(fā)展的市場(chǎng)的需求。此外,業(yè)務(wù)運(yùn)作的即時(shí)同步將提供更多的安全,使團(tuán)隊(duì)能夠?qū)崟r(shí)修改安全系統(tǒng),并克服潛在的網(wǎng)絡(luò)安全威脅。
這就是通過良好同步的業(yè)務(wù)操作可以實(shí)現(xiàn)的目標(biāo):
*總體開發(fā)所需的時(shí)間將從幾周減少到幾天或幾小時(shí)。
*可以避免對(duì)軟件數(shù)據(jù)庫(kù)中存儲(chǔ)的數(shù)據(jù)的網(wǎng)絡(luò)威脅。
*實(shí)時(shí)同步將在今天不斷發(fā)展的網(wǎng)絡(luò)攻擊中加強(qiáng)安全操作。
3. 快速發(fā)現(xiàn)錯(cuò)誤
DevOps 幫助組織實(shí)時(shí)檢測(cè)錯(cuò)誤。通過這樣做,它可以幫助團(tuán)隊(duì)提高產(chǎn)品質(zhì)量和產(chǎn)品交付所需的時(shí)間。更重要的是,DevOps 通過提前檢測(cè)錯(cuò)誤并避免將其轉(zhuǎn)化為不可逆的錯(cuò)誤而節(jié)省了大量資源。通過使用 DevOps,團(tuán)隊(duì)可以輕松快速地檢測(cè)錯(cuò)誤,避免可能導(dǎo)致負(fù)面性能的瓶頸情況。
在現(xiàn)代技術(shù)的幫助下,DevOps 系統(tǒng)可以幫助組織通過暗示性的解決方案來(lái)檢測(cè)和克服它。
DevOps 的商業(yè)效益
DevOps 有助于企業(yè)適應(yīng)不斷變化的市場(chǎng),并有效地加強(qiáng)業(yè)務(wù)運(yùn)作,以滿足不斷增長(zhǎng)的市場(chǎng)需求。DevOps 的分析特性有助于組織理解需求并進(jìn)行必要的更改。
簡(jiǎn)單看一下 DevOps 的商業(yè)利益。
1. 提高業(yè)務(wù)敏捷性
*業(yè)務(wù)敏捷性這個(gè)術(shù)語(yǔ)是指業(yè)務(wù)適應(yīng)現(xiàn)代變化并提高用戶需求的能力。下面是 DevOps 如何為企業(yè)帶來(lái)更高的敏捷性。
*通過同步業(yè)務(wù)目標(biāo)和開發(fā)框架,為業(yè)務(wù)流程帶來(lái)一致性。
*為工程帶來(lái)靈活性并實(shí)現(xiàn)一致的開發(fā)。
*定期審核所有軟件、補(bǔ)丁和版本。
*創(chuàng)建一個(gè)協(xié)作框架并帶來(lái)適應(yīng)性。
2. 具成本效益
*DevOps 帶來(lái)了自動(dòng)化和內(nèi)聚策略,以提高運(yùn)營(yíng)效率。因此,它大大降低了運(yùn)營(yíng)成本。除了節(jié)省成本,這里還有一些業(yè)務(wù)可以通過 DevOps 實(shí)現(xiàn)的方面。
*最小化管理系統(tǒng)的成本。
*提供比預(yù)期恢復(fù)點(diǎn)目標(biāo)(RPO)和恢復(fù)時(shí)間目標(biāo)(RTO)更高的數(shù)據(jù)恢復(fù)(DR)。
*給消費(fèi)者帶來(lái)更多的信心。
3. 更快的解決時(shí)間
一個(gè)希望持續(xù)改善產(chǎn)品/應(yīng)用程序用戶體驗(yàn)的組織需要更快的上市時(shí)間。這就是 DevOps 提供并增強(qiáng)用戶體驗(yàn)的東西。許多軟件公司遵循 DevOps 策略,向最終用戶提供即時(shí)更新,并增加更新頻率。
降低商業(yè)風(fēng)險(xiǎn)
協(xié)作努力對(duì)于組織更好地理解其業(yè)務(wù)風(fēng)險(xiǎn)并相應(yīng)地規(guī)劃其業(yè)務(wù)操作至關(guān)重要。DevOps 為您帶來(lái)了團(tuán)隊(duì)之間的這種協(xié)作,并使業(yè)務(wù)風(fēng)險(xiǎn)緩解成為額外收獲。它結(jié)合了人工智能和機(jī)器學(xué)習(xí)算法,通過自動(dòng)化系統(tǒng)檢測(cè)異常。
毫無(wú)疑問,DevOps 可以幫助 CIO 應(yīng)對(duì)挑戰(zhàn),推動(dòng)開發(fā)進(jìn)程。DevOps 通過協(xié)作和自動(dòng)化提供了一個(gè)高性能的系統(tǒng)。因此,根據(jù)您的業(yè)務(wù)需求使用 DevOps 轉(zhuǎn)換您現(xiàn)有的業(yè)務(wù)工作流程,并獲得所有 DevOps 的好處。
企業(yè)該如何構(gòu)建企業(yè)云原生DevOps體系?
行云CloudOS致力于讓開發(fā)者專注于業(yè)務(wù)創(chuàng)新,與DevOps真正的理念不謀而合。行云 CloudOS 封裝 Docker、K8S 等底層技術(shù),為用戶提供可視化操作頁(yè)面,讓傳統(tǒng)應(yīng)用研發(fā)團(tuán)隊(duì)無(wú)縫轉(zhuǎn)型為云原生數(shù)字化應(yīng)用研發(fā)團(tuán)隊(duì)。
在云原生數(shù)字化時(shí)代,應(yīng)用與云原生平臺(tái)分離,IT 團(tuán)隊(duì)中相關(guān)人員分別承擔(dān)應(yīng)用研發(fā)、應(yīng)用運(yùn)維、平臺(tái)運(yùn)維等角色。Docker、K8S 等云原生技術(shù)為底層平臺(tái)技術(shù),平臺(tái)運(yùn)維人員需要學(xué)習(xí)并掌握,應(yīng)用研發(fā)和應(yīng)用運(yùn)維人員將更聚焦于應(yīng)用本身,不需要過多關(guān)注底層云原生平臺(tái)技術(shù)。因而CloudOS 云原生平臺(tái)對(duì)底層技術(shù)進(jìn)行封裝,給應(yīng)用團(tuán)隊(duì)提供友好易使用的可視化操作頁(yè)面,讓應(yīng)用團(tuán)隊(duì)不需要學(xué)習(xí) Docker、K8S 技術(shù)也能高效進(jìn)行數(shù)字化應(yīng)用創(chuàng)新。
文章來(lái)源:qaseven